    There is something to be said for leveling your group together - especially your 1st group. I know I learned a ton of just little tweaks along the way. Stuff like keybindings and macro adjustments to they fit together well.

    That and I really like the classic leveling experience and I've done the 1-60 thing 3 times now (solo mage, prot war - leveled with my wife's holy priest, and now 5-boxing WMMMPr). Multiboxing wise, l I think I made just over 1000g just from leveling, and I maxed professions as I went.

    Thinking about group/account set up, I suppose it may be best with 1 account that has all your healers - you may swap them around a bit, but you'll probably always want a heal.

    Yea, I followed the same line of reasoning and decided to make my main/pilot account be the one I build comps around.

    I have my resto shaman / resto druid / disc priest that I can mix and match with any combination of 4x warriors / mages / shamans. Having my healers spread across 4 accounts would make compositions really awkward.
